CPV (Common Procurement Vocabulary) codes are the standardised classification system used across UK and EU public procurement. Every tender notice includes at least one CPV code that describes what the buyer is purchasing.

Here are the most frequently used divisions in UK procurement:
| Code | Category |
|---|---|
| 09 | Petroleum products, fuel, electricity, and energy |
| 30 | Office and computing machinery |
| 33 | Medical equipment and pharmaceuticals |
| 34 | Transport equipment |
| 38 | Laboratory and measuring instruments |
| 39 | Furniture and furnishings |
| 42 | Industrial machinery |
| 44 | Construction structures and materials |
| 45 | Construction work |
| 48 | Software packages and information systems |
| 50 | Repair and maintenance |
| 55 | Hotel, restaurant, and catering |
| 60 | Transport services |
| 63 | Supporting transport services |
| 64 | Postal and telecommunications |
| 66 | Financial and insurance services |
| 70 | Real estate services |
| 71 | Architectural and engineering services |
| 72 | IT services |
| 73 | Research and development |
| 75 | Administration, defence, and social security |
| 77 | Agricultural, forestry, and landscaping services |
| 79 | Business services |
| 80 | Education and training |
| 85 | Health and social work |
| 90 | Sewage, refuse, cleaning, and environmental |
| 92 | Recreational, cultural, and sporting services |
| 98 | Other community and personal services |
